Earth Day HikeTuesday, April 22 � 3:30 - 5 p.m.Harvard Trailhead � Ohio & Erie Canal ReservationCelebrate Earth Day along the �Burning River.� Meet at the Harvard Road trailhead and hike south while discussing how pollution in the Cuyahoga River led to a national call for action. Keep an eye out for bald eagles along the way. The trailhead is located off Old Harvard Avenue in the Ohio & Erie Canal Reservation, between Harvard Avenue and Jennings Road in Cleveland.
